error copying a body to another catpart (feature naming)

I´m Trying to copy a body to another catpart file (using copy/paste funcionality), but it doesn´t work, I am receiving this message from a dialog box "Error pasting data- Copy Paste operation is impossible due to selection problems in master part or in master feature.The feature naming is incomplete. Recreate the master feature."

Where I can find the "feature naming" parameter?

Angelo.... you should be able to copy&paste the part body. I'm not sure what the error message means, but try copy&paste-special and pick As Specified. That might avoid the naming problem.

       Thanks for your comment, the issue is located on the original catpart. When I open the file it shows me a dialog box "error naming data", and the file doesn´t open. but when  I use the option to open the file File->New From, I can open the file, using this one I need to save the file with another name, but when a close this new file and try to open agan the problem happens again, this is the reason that I am trying to copy the bodies to another file.

What Release and Service Pack are you on?
Try IBM's Tech. Support website.  I've seen a PMR out for this issue.
In my case I had the problem in R12 SP04 but could not replicate the same problem in SP07.
